The Ecological and Societal Balance of Wildfires
Canada, Greece, South Africa, Australia, Chile
Climate change is increasing wildfire frequency and severity, causing ecological shifts and societal damage. Many nations are not prepared for these trends, others mis-frame the issue as a human versus nature conflict. On my Watson, I will investigate fire history, ecology, and management in fire-prone countries. I aim to understand the feasibility of balancing ecological needs against societal fears.
